This is an unmissable chance to combine two Scandinavian icons, and two countries, on one unforgettable trip. Beginning with the dazzling disco-light displays over Norway’s Northern Lights capital, you’ll then board a bus east, stopping for a night in remote Narvik before heading on, via the Arctic Circle train, for a stay at Sweden’s iconic ICEHOTEL.
Day 1: Depart for Tromso
Fly to Tromso and take the airport shuttle to the city centre, then check into your hotel. We recommend the Clarion Collection Hotel With for its wonderful harbour views and top-floor relaxation area, perfect for views of the Northern Lights. Stays here also include afternoon waffles and a light evening meal, on the house. The rest of the day is free to explore, and there’s plenty to discover, whether it’s the informative Polaria Museum, itself a fabulous guide to the frozen north, or the many excellent restaurants and seemingly limitless supply of pubs that dot this lively city.
Day 2: Tromso excursions
While Tromso itself is full of bustling charm, the region’s real highlights lie beyond the city limits. You’ll have the chance to take in some of its many delights today with a choice of optional excursions. There’s everything from husky-sled rides and snowmobile trips through the wilderness to Northern Lights dinner cruises and distillery tastings. And, in the evening, be sure to book onto an aurora safari to catch the light show in all its ethereal splendour – weather permitting, of course.
Day 3: Bus to Narvik
Your trans-Scandinavian adventure begins in earnest today as you board the bus to Narvik. Grab a seat by the window if you can, for the best view of snow-dusted crags and icy fjords. On arrival, check into the Scandic Narvik whose contemporary rooms and 15th-floor sky bar look out across the mountainous surrounds. If you’ve time, take the chance for a cable car ride to the summit of Narvikfjellet.
Stay: Scandic Narvik
Day 4: Journey to ICEHOTEL
Today you’ll board the Arctic Circle Train for a memorable cross-border journey into Swedish Lapland. Along the way, you’ll race past the snowy mountain resort of Björkliden and Abisko National Park before sweeping into Kiruna for the short transfer to ICEHOTEL. Enjoy a tour of the hotel on arrival before checking into your freshly sculpted Ice Room. Art Suite upgrades are also available. The rest of the day is left free for optional adventures; snowmobiling, ice carving and Northern Lights tours compete for your attention alongside the likes of ice-carving classes and multi-course gourmet dining experiences.
Day 5: Depart ICEHOTEL
Wake from your night on ice with a warm glass of lingonberry juice and a sauna. Then, after breakfast, you’ll transfer back to Kiruna for your flight home.
